Haverel Systems derives fifty-two percent of annual revenue from Ostrand Logistics, up from thirty-one percent two years ago. Contract renews in nine months; pricing pressure expected. Exposure spans the Brynmoor plant and two service teams. Mitigation options: diversify pipeline, renegotiate term length, or pre-agree volume floors. Finance has stress-tested a partial loss scenario; results attached separately. Board input requested before the renewal strategy is fixed. Proposed direction appears in the confidential note below.

internal memo for kawip-hadug: Headcount on the Wenwyn team goes from 7 to 140 by the end of January. Gross margin on Wenwyn came in at 20 percent against a plan of 15 percent.

This change addresses the findings from the Corvale internal review of the Lanternfish sidecar. We now validate all inbound metric payloads against a strict schema before aggregation, drop oversized batches rather than truncating them, and run the flush loop under a dedicated unprivileged account. No network-facing behavior changes except the new payload size ceiling. Flush cadence and buffer bounds were re-derived from production traces taken in the Hollybrook cluster. The resulting constants are defined as follows.

tuning constants:
QUOTAS = {
    "druwyn": 5,
    "holix": 5,
    "zorath": 5,
    "holwyn": 10,
}

Subject: Cut-over done — order cutoff rule

Hi — quick summary for your review. We moved Flourhaus's bakery order-cutoff rule off the old cron hack and onto the Ovenline scheduler last night. Cutoff now enforces at 14:00 local per store, with a grace queue for in-flight carts. The service now runs with the following configuration.

service settings:
PRAIX_LOG_LEVEL=error
PRAIX_METRICS_HOST=metrics.praix.qorvelcorp.corp
PRAIX_POOL_SIZE=16